CHECK_ID_extra737="7.37"
CHECK_TITLE_extra737="[extra737] Check KMS keys with key rotation disabled (Not Scored) (Not part of CIS benchmark)"
CHECK_SCORED_extra737="NOT_SCORED"
CHECK_TYPE_extra737="EXTRA"
CHECK_SEVERITY_extra737="Medium"
CHECK_ASFF_RESOURCE_TYPE_extra737="AwsKmsKey"
CHECK_ALTERNATE_check737="extra737"
CHECK_ASFF_COMPLIANCE_TYPE_extra737="ens-op.exp.11.aws.kms.3"
CHECK_SERVICENAME_extra737="kms"
extra737(){
textInfo "Looking for KMS keys in all regions... "
for regx in $REGIONS; do
LIST_OF_CUSTOMER_KMS_KEYS=$($AWSCLI kms list-aliases $PROFILE_OPT --region $regx --output text |grep -v :alias/aws/ |awk '{ print $4 }')
if [[ $LIST_OF_CUSTOMER_KMS_KEYS ]];then
for key in $LIST_OF_CUSTOMER_KMS_KEYS; do
CHECK_ROTATION=$($AWSCLI kms get-key-rotation-status --key-id $key $PROFILE_OPT --region $regx --output text)
CHECK_STATUS=$($AWSCLI kms describe-key --key-id $key $PROFILE_OPT --region $regx --output json | jq -r '.KeyMetadata.KeyState')
if [[ $CHECK_STATUS == "PendingDeletion" ]]; then
textInfo "$regx: KMS key $key is pending deletion and cannot be rotated" "$regx"
elif [[ $CHECK_ROTATION == "False" ]]; then
textFail "$regx: KMS key $key has rotation disabled!" "$regx"
else
textPass "$regx: KMS key $key has rotation enabled" "$regx"
fi
done
else
textInfo "$regx: No KMS keys found" "$regx"
fi
done
}
